Output 37d68758ffd06d8e50055fffbf9ebb30c59c7bb8969aa5c58efd25d447e1bc23: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8c632bb8026aebaf2e685fadd66c23ac8513be8 OP_EQUALVERIFY OP_CHECKSIG
address
1NDoCZCciJbBVpRMhUg4rMZFebXDC98zcb
transaction
37d68758ffd06d8e50055fffbf9ebb30c59c7bb8969aa5c58efd25d447e1bc23
confirmations
427987
spent
true